Each day, a new piece of sonic exploration arrives from the workshop of Vinston and Z. Booty Machine is a daily dose of raw, instrumental creativity, built from the ground up with experimental guitar and bass tones. You won't find polished pop songs here; instead, each episode is a unique soundscape where riffs, textures, and rhythms are bent, layered, and pushed into new shapes. The dynamic between the creators is central-Vinston brings his distinct touch to the foundational work from Z's own Bass O Matic project, resulting in a collaborative and unpredictable audio journal. Tuning into this podcast means accessing a steady stream of ideas in progress, a behind-the-scenes listen to the process of building grooves and melodies from the strings up. It’s for anyone curious about the sculpting of sound, the potential of a six-string or a bass line when the rulebook is set aside. The daily format ensures a constant, evolving conversation between two artists, offering listeners a regular immersion into the unrefined and compelling world of instrumental experimentation.
